Section 6: Authorisation for payment of pension

The Kerala Payment of Pension to Members of Legislature Rules, 1977State Rules of Kerala · 1976

(1) On receipt of the order sanctioning pension under rule 4, the Accountant General shall prepare a Pension Payment Order and forward the same to the Treasury Officer of the Treasury mentioned in the application under rule 3.

(1A) The Pension Payment Order, shall be in two halves of which one known as the disburser's half shall be in Form III and the other half known as the Pensioner's half shall be in Form III A.

(2) On receipt of the Pension Payment Order the Treasury Officer shall keep the disburser's half in the Treasury in such manner that the pensioner shall not have access there and deliver the pensioner's half to the pensioner in person when he appears to receive payment of the pension for the first time:

Provided that where a pensioner opt to receive his pension by postal money order, the pensioner's half of the Pension Payment Order need not be handed over to the Pensioner.

(3) In issuing a Pension Payment Order, the Accountant General shall attach to each half of the order a specimen signature of the pensioner if he can sign his name, and the thumb and finger impressions of the left hand of the pensioner; if he cannot sign his name.

(4) A Pensioner drawing pension direct from a Treasury shall claim it in Form IV and payment shall be made:-

(a) in the case of a pensioner drawing pension in person only if he produces the pensioner's half of the pension payment order, before the Treasury Officer whenever he claims pension;

(b) In the case of a pensioner drawing his pension in absentia only if he has furnished the life certificate in prescribed Form IV.

(5) Each payment of pension shall be entered on the reverse of both halves of the Pension Payment Order, both entries being attested at the time of payment under the dated signature of the Treasury Officer.

(6) A pensioner may opt to receive his pension by postal money order.

(7) Where a pensioner has opted to receive pension by postal money order, the amount shall be sent by postal money order at Government cost to the address furnished by the pensioner:

Provided that the payment of pension for the first time shall be made only on the personal appearance of the pensioner at the Treasury and after identification of the pensioner with reference to the details available in the Pension Payment Order and on production of the copy of the letter of the Accountant General forwarding his Pension Payment Order to the Treasury Officer.

(8) The procedure prescribed in the Kerala Treasury Rules for payment of pension shall, subject to the provisions of these rules, apply to the payment of pension under the Act.
